Term Loan Standstill Period means each period commencing on the date of the occurrence of an Event of Default under any Term Loan Financing Document and ending upon the date which is 120 days after the date the Revolving Agent has received a Term Loan Default Notice with respect to such Event of Default. For the avoidance of doubt, the term “Term Loan Standstill Period” shall have no application with respect to actions taken solely with respect to the Term Loan Priority Collateral or which would otherwise constitute Enforcement Actions or other actions taken by Term Loan Creditors as unsecured creditors of the Obligors.
